In the ever-evolving construction industry, the demand for Ultra-High Performance Concrete (UHPC) has skyrocketed, primarily due to its superior strength, durability, and aesthetic qualities. To meet this growing demand, advanced planetary mixers have emerged as essential equipment for achieving the exceptional mixing quality required for UHPC. These mixers are designed to ensure uniform dispersion of materials, resulting in a more consistent and high-quality end product. The advantages of using planetary mixers for UHPC are manifold. Their innovative design allows for complete mixing of components, including aggregates, cement, and additives, without leaving any unmixed material. This results in a homogenous mixture that enhances the performance characteristics of UHPC.
